How to remove exhaust hose?
Anybody have any advice on how to easily remove 4" exhaust hose from a 454 mag with the silent choice diverters? the hose seems to be stuck on their pretty tight. And it's not very soft or pliable.
Also, any advice to reinstall new hose? Soap and water? other lubricant?

I have to remove my header/ exhaust manifold to get mine off. As far as putting them back on, I just wipe a thin layer of grease, but any lubricant will do. It will burn off once it gets hot.

if you plaln on replacing them just take a razor knofe and cut a slit in them and get under it with a hose tool and brake loose were its melted on..when installing the new hose get soft wall hose,,i just use a little water to slide the hose on,,its real easy to slide the new hose on..

On my 454 mag mpi's it was less of a fight for me to un-bolt the riser. Then did a little inspection. Put the new hose on and the weight of the riser made it easy to make the slight bend to reinstall the riser back on the manifold. Fighting the hose sucks.

you hafta take one end or the other off. then take a small screwdriver and jam it between hose and riser or hose and exh tip. spray WD40 or similar down opening made by screwdriver. work screwdriver around outside of riser-inside of hose continuing to spray WD in it. once you go all way around it'll come off. the hose glues itself to whatever it is clamped on real good over time.
